This road less traveled got steeper and rougher.
I'm thinking this is the Granville Bad Road ![]() ![]() This was fun for a few miles, would have liked to got more pictures but it was too steep to stop. This passed a few abandoned houses and farms, but then came to an (open) gate and a No Trespassing sign. ![]() So I turned around and back down the hill I went. At the bottom, made a left and shortly came to the Dry Fork river. No bridge, but a low water ford. Sadly, the water was about 5 feet deep. Having forgotten my add on pontoon I turned around. Again. Back up the way I came, and continued on the Jenningston Road. ![]() Thru Sully (have to check out Sully Rd sometime) and down to 33 East. Nothing picture worthy for a bit. Until I got here. ![]() continued down Sugarlands, then onto Close Mtn Rd. ![]() ![]() ![]() I've been thru here a lot, one of my favorite rides. |
